Understanding Termite Actions



To comprehend termite habits, observe their patterns of movement and feeding practices carefully. Termites are social pests that collaborate in large colonies to forage for food. They connect via pheromones, which help them collaborate their tasks and find food resources successfully. As they search for cellulose-rich products to feed upon, termites produce distinctive passages and mud tubes to protect themselves from killers and keep a secure setting.

Termites are most energetic during warmer months when they can quickly access food resources and replicate quickly. They're drawn in to damp and decaying wood, making homes with dampness problems especially at risk to invasions. By comprehending their habits, you can determine prospective entrance points and take safety nets to safeguard your building.

Watch out for indicators of termite task, such as thrown out wings, mud tubes, and hollow-sounding wood. By being aggressive and attending to any type of issues promptly, you can decrease the threat of termite damage and guarantee the long-term integrity of your home.

Proactive Termite Prevention



To stop termite infestations, you ought to evaluate your building frequently for any indications of termites or favorable problems. Termites are sneaky pests that can create significant damages prior to you even understand they're there. Begin by checking for mud tubes along your structure, droppings that appear like sawdust, or disposed of wings near windowsills.

Stay clear of piling wood against your home, as it develops a direct path for termites to invade.

Take into consideration making use of termite-resistant materials when building or restoring. Routinely trim shrubs and trees to avoid them from touching your residence, as termites can use these as bridges. Effective Termite Treatment Alternatives



Consider applying targeted termite therapies to eradicate existing invasions and prevent future termite damage. When dealing with termite problems, it's critical to choose the most reliable therapy alternatives readily available.

Below are some suggestions to aid you tackle your termite trouble efficiently:

- ** Liquid Termiticides **: Applied to the soil around the boundary of your home, liquid termiticides create a protective barrier that protects against termites from going into the framework.

- ** Lure Stations **: Bait stations are purposefully positioned around your residential or commercial property to draw in termites.
